Data analysts in India can earn anywhere from ₹3 lakh to ₹18 lakh per year, depending on experience, skills, and industry. In 2025, salaries for these roles are expected to rise as demand for data-driven decision-making grows.

Data analyst salaries can vary significantly across industries, depending on the demand for data-driven decision-making in each sector. Industries like IT, finance, and e-commerce offer higher salaries due to the complexity and importance of data in their operations.
Here’s a detailed breakdown of the average salary of data analyst in India across different industries,
Industry |
Average Salary (₹/annum) |
Top Companies |
IT and Technology |
₹4-7 lakhs |
TCS, Infosys, Wipro |
Finance and Banking |
₹8-14 lakhs |
HDFC, ICICI, Goldman Sachs |
E-commerce |
₹9-13 lakhs |
Amazon, Flipkart, Myntra |
Healthcare |
₹7-14 lakhs |
Apollo Hospitals, Cipla |
Manufacturing |
₹3-5 lakhs |
Tata Motors, Larsen & Toubro |
Retail and FMCG |
₹7-10 lakhs |
Hindustan Unilever, Procter & Gamble |
Note: Salary data is sourced from Glassdoor and may vary depending on the company, industry, and location.
The average salary of data analyst in India may vary significantly based on location. Cities like Bangalore and Mumbai offer higher salaries due to the presence of tech hubs, financial institutions, and large corporations.
City |
Average Salary (₹/annum) |
Key Industries |
Bangalore |
₹6-12 lakhs |
IT, Startups, Tech Giants |
Mumbai |
₹5-11 lakhs |
Finance, Consulting, Banking |
Delhi NCR |
₹5-10 lakhs |
IT, E-commerce, Corporate |
Hyderabad |
₹5-10 lakhs |
IT, Pharma, Startups |
Pune |
₹4-9 lakhs |
IT, Manufacturing, Financial Services |
Chennai |
₹4-8 lakhs |
IT, Manufacturing |
Note: Salary data is sourced from Glassdoor and may vary depending on the company and experience level.

If you're a data analyst looking to work abroad, now’s the time. Countries across sectors like IT, finance, and healthcare are actively hiring data professionals. For Indian analysts, this opens doors to exciting global careers.
Here’s a look at some of the top countries where data analysts are highly sought after:
United States:
Tech giants like Google and Amazon offer salaries between $94,000 - $146,000.
United Kingdom:
Financial institutions like Barclays and HSBC offer £41,000 - £57,000.
Canada:
Cities like Toronto pay between CAD 65,000 - CAD 90,000.
Germany:
With a strong focus on finance and manufacturing, salaries are around €50,000 - €80,000.
Australia:
Data analysts in Sydney and Melbourne earn AUD 80,000 - AUD 110,000.

AI can assist data analysts by automating repetitive tasks and providing faster insights, but it is unlikely to completely replace them. Human expertise is essential for interpreting complex data, understanding business contexts, and making strategic decisions. Rather than replacing analysts, AI will likely enhance their efficiency and capabilities, improving their contributions to industries.

Data scientists generally earn higher salaries due to their advanced skills in machine learning and predictive analytics. While the data analyst salary in India ranges around ₹4–10 lakhs per annum, data scientists can earn ₹8–20 lakhs or more, depending on their experience and expertise.
Like many analytical roles, being a data analyst can be stressful at times due to tight deadlines, data quality issues, or high stakeholder expectations. However, it also offers intellectual stimulation, problem-solving opportunities, and job satisfaction. Good time management and communication skills can help reduce workplace stress.
Yes, startups typically offer lower base salaries than MNCs but often compensate with benefits like stock options, growth opportunities, or flexible working conditions. Despite the differences, data analyst salaries in startups can still be competitive, especially for skilled professionals.
Remote work can sometimes lead to slightly lower data analyst salaries, particularly in regions with a lower cost of living. However, many companies maintain competitive pay for remote workers, with salaries for skilled data analysts typically ranging between ₹4–9 lakhs.
A fresher data analyst in India can expect to earn between ₹3–5 lakh per year. The exact salary depends on factors like the company, location, and your skills. Knowing tools like Excel, SQL, and Power BI can help you get higher starting pay.
Cities like Bengaluru, Mumbai, and Gurgaon usually offer the highest salaries for data analysts in India. This is because these cities have many tech companies, startups, and global firms willing to pay more for skilled professionals.
Yes, salaries for data analysts vary by industry. Roles in finance, e-commerce, and IT often pay more compared to education or government sectors. Choosing a high-growth industry can boost your earning potential.
Yes, certifications like Microsoft Power BI, Tableau, or Google Data Analytics can increase your salary. They prove your skills and make you stand out to employers, which can lead to better-paying opportunities.
Many companies offer performance-based bonuses and incentives that can add 10–30% to a data analyst’s base salary. In some industries like finance and consulting, bonuses can be even higher.
Freelance data analysts can earn competitive rates, often between ₹500–₹2,000 per hour depending on their experience and project type. Freelancing offers flexibility but requires strong networking and self-marketing skills.
With consistent skill upgrades and experience, a data analyst’s salary can double in 3–5 years. Moving to higher-paying industries or roles like senior analyst or analytics manager can speed up growth.
Yes, skills in Python, R, or SQL can significantly boost a data analyst’s salary. These languages are in high demand for data manipulation, automation, and advanced analytics.
A senior data analyst in India with 6–8 years of experience can earn between ₹8–18 lakh annually. Professionals with expertise in big data tools, machine learning, and cloud platforms can earn even more.
